New Orleans BBQ Shrimp Recipe

Difficulty: Easy | Total Time: 30 Minutes | Active Time: | Makes: It takes at lest 1-2 lbs of shrimp per person

New Orleans BBQ Shrimp. This is a crowd pleaser.I made it for the first time and it was a hit,So much so that I feel that I would post it .I love easy recipe’s and this one doesn’t get much easier

INGREDIENTS
  • 3 lbs. Shrimp heads on that gives you the flavors your looking for !
  • 1 stick butter salted or unsalted is OK I can't taste the difference when I made it either way
  • 1/2 cup olive oil extra virgin
  • 2 Tbs Rosemary dried
  • 1 Tbs Oregano dried
  • 1 Tbs Cayenne pepper or to taste I use 2
  • 1 Garlic clove mined
  • 1 Loaf French bread
INSTRUCTIONS
  1. Preheat oven to 350.In a sauce pan melt butter and add olive oil add rosemary ,oregano,cheyenne pepper ,salt and pepper to taste then add garlic. cook for 2 minutes or until garlic is soft.you can add 1 cup of water to get more dipping sauce which I have done before .
  2. Place shrimp in a baking pan,Pour sauce over the shrimp and put into oven cook for 10 minutes .Stir and cook another 10 minutes at that time they should be done depending on the size of your shrimp .Heat french bread and serve in bowls or deep plates. I doubled the recipe and it was enough for four people.
